Output ae21bfb5d28fe5618af604f0778a7a50b3437a162753badb01fb9acebd83ff33:6

value
662596
script pubkey
OP_0 OP_PUSHBYTES_20 f7fbace397de89afea8e41fc88c5294cac32f760
address
bc1q7la6ecuhm6y6l65wg87g33fffjkr9amqex5tqw
transaction
ae21bfb5d28fe5618af604f0778a7a50b3437a162753badb01fb9acebd83ff33